im new to this site and thought i would share my project with you guys. I just started building this in november and all the fab is done now its currently going thrugh the body work.


I found the camaro in north dakota in oct which was 90% rust free except for windshild area. Due to a rough life and a few accidents the quarters, door skins, and 1 fender is being replaced due to heavy filler and poor patch panels. car was complete with orginial 327

things done to date

Art morrison corvette front subframe & tri 4bar rear subframe
9 inch strange alum center 3:90 gears 31 spline axles
strange coil overs
art morison headers and motormounts
DSE mini tubs & firewall panel
15.1 agr power rack
ls3 & t56 built by street rod engines W/24t reluctor cam & head work
willwood pedel assy with 3 masters cyls
fuel safe 22 gal fuel cell
8 point roll cage removeable side & center bars
08 z06 14" front and 13.5" rear brakes
